How to optimize flow?

Hello everyone, I am working on an A.I project(https://content.butchi.ai/) to create multilingual content and I have chosen Typebot for implementation. I'm facing a small issue; currently, I have managed to create 5 languages, but my flow is too complicated, and I want to optimize it because I plan to support over 100 languages. What should I do? Assuming that all bots are the same and the only difference is the language localization I would propose to create a starting structure from which to have the language selected and with each option chosen you are directed to a specific bot with its own perfectly ordered flow that you would only have to duplicate with the specific translations for each language. This way even the bot link (https://typebot.co/bot-name) can have its own specific localization such as https://typebot.co/bot-name-EN - https://typebot.co/bot-name-IT etc etc) For each selected language you will be directed (with the specific block) “Typebot” to the relevant bot. This way you will certainly have more order than thinking of developing one bot with N streams
